Android恶意代码的静态检测研究的开题报告_第1页
Android恶意代码的静态检测研究的开题报告_第2页
Android恶意代码的静态检测研究的开题报告_第3页
全文预览已结束

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

Android恶意代码的静态检测研究的开题报告一、选题背景随着智能手机的普及,人们将越来越多的数据存储在手机中,例如照片、通讯录、密码等。对于这些宝贵的数据,黑客们也垂涎已久,并通过编写恶意软件来窃取,以实现其利益。在恶意代码的种类中,Android恶意代码因其危害性大、传播范围广等因素而备受关注。而恶意软件的静态检测是一种有效的手段,将有利于保护用户的隐私,并提高安全性。因此,本文选题为“Android恶意代码的静态检测研究”,旨在通过分析恶意代码的特征,建立模型,实现静态检测,确保用户的数据安全。二、研究内容1.恶意代码分析:分析已知的Android恶意代码,提取其特征,如危害性、传播方式等。2.学习模型建立:通过学习正常应用程序的特征,建立模型来区分普通应用程序和恶意代码。3.静态检测算法开发:利用已知的特征以及学习到的模型,编写静态检测算法,对未知的Android应用程序进行检测。4.实验验证:通过真实的Android应用程序进行实验验证,评估静态检测算法的准确性、可行性和实用性。三、研究意义1.提高用户数据安全:通过静态检测算法,及时发现并排除恶意代码,保障用户的数据安全。2.促进移动应用市场的健康发展:通过识别和过滤恶意应用,促进移动应用市场的健康发展,提高用户使用安全感。3.推动恶意代码研究的进一步发展:通过分析已知的恶意代码以及不断完善的模型和算法体系,可以推动恶意代码研究的进一步发展。四、研究方法本研究采用基于特征提取的静态分析方法,结合机器学习算法,对Android应用程序进行有效的识别和分类。1.特征提取方法:提取代码特征(例如代码结构、API调用、权限等),分析代码的行为(例如系统调用、网络请求、文件读写等)。2.机器学习算法:采用监督学习算法,如支持向量机(SVM)、神经网络等,通过训练模型,进行自动分类。3.实验验证方法:通过自建的样本库和已有的公开数据集,进行实验验证,评估模型的准确性和实用性。五、进度安排1.恶意代码分析:5月底前完成相关文献调研和数据收集。2.学习模型建立:6月初开始对数据集进行预处理和特征提取,并训练基本的分类模型。3.静态检测算法开发:6月中旬开始进行相关算法的设计和实现。4.实验验证:7月初针对数据集进行实验验证,并对模型进行调整和优化。6.论文撰写:8月完成论文初稿,9月进行修改和完善,10月提交最终论文。六、预期成果1.提出一种基于特征提取和机器学习的Android恶意代码静态检测方法。2.构建实验数据集并对检测算法进行实

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论